no-double winning chances exceed 80 % (albeit with some gammons lost). However, the winning and gammon chances for the opponent would increase very radically after a double according to the rollout (much more slightly according to xg roller++).

No--the no double winning/gammon chances shouldn't be compared with the double winning/gammon chances. The No double result is very similar to an evaluation, whereas the Double result is a rollout.

Agree that correct play is double/pass.
